Post by: TW on December 20, 2004, 02:27:43 AM
>>Yes, the grips are available through Rohrbaugh even though they are not listed on the web site.  Cost is $85 per set + Shipp & Handling.  Call on the old 800 number but remember they have moved to the new location now in case you plan to send a check (I posted the new addie on an earlier thread).  Bear in mind too that the R-Boys are still in transition, so they may not be as responsive as we have come to enjoy.  And definately call them because I'm unsure of the new Fax number if you were planning to Fax an order.

Eric told me the other day that these new grips are "the look" they wanted to achieve from the get go.  He even put them on his personal R9.  But hold on to those original blue grips as they will become collectors items one day, as will guns with the old "Farmingdale" designation on the sides.
